    If we were all well behaved investors, we would be oblivious to market movements and most likely snapping up a few cheaper YOJ shares as the business has not materially changed.

    Unfortunately, our sentiment towards a stock is often influenced by it's share price as it is the most visible yardstick for a company.

    I'm not selling because I bought YOJ with 3-5 years in mind... I'm sure there will be many more big fluctuations in share price between now and then.

    It may be unsubstantiated fear causing your desire to sell. Ask yourself why before any transaction
